National Day Deals and Restaurant Promotions

National days provide a popular avenue for restaurants and retailers to offer special deals and free items. Drugstore Divas has compiled a list of top national days for freebies and deals, broken down by month to help consumers plan. These events often require specific actions, such as making a donation or visiting a participating location on a specific date.

January through March Promotions

  • January: Movie theaters are noted to lead the pack with free popcorn and refill deals.
  • March:
    • National Pancake Day (March 4, 2025): IHOP offers a free short stack of pancakes when customers make a donation to Children’s Miracle Network hospitals.
    • Pi Day (March 14, 2025): Restaurants may offer discounted or free pizza or sweet pie to celebrate the mathematical constant Pi (3.14).

Accessing Freebies and Important Considerations

Securing free samples and offers typically involves signing up for brand newsletters, joining rewards programs, or following specific social media channels. For example, Hunt4Freebies recommends following them on Facebook, Twitter, and Google+ for the latest updates.

Eligibility and Requirements

  • Membership: Many offers, such as those from MyPanera or L’Oreal Gold Rewards, require membership in a specific program.
  • Purchase Requirements: Some deals are contingent on a purchase, such as the MyPanera bakery treat requiring a minimum delivery order or the Corner Bakery BOGO deal requiring the purchase of one item.
  • Geographic Restrictions: Offers like the Uniqlo reopening freebies and the Chicken Salad Chick grand opening are location-specific.
  • Limited Supplies: Many offers, particularly event-based freebies, are available "while supplies last," emphasizing the need for early arrival.
  • Military Status: Veterans Day freebies often require proof of military service.
